Chemical Property Profile of ethyl 2-amino-1-(4-bromophenyl)-1H-pyrrolo[2,3-b]quinoxaline-3-carboxylate
Property Insights of ethyl 2-amino-1-(4-bromophenyl)-1H-pyrrolo[2,3-b]quinoxaline-3-carboxylate
The XLogP value of 4.0951 indicates that ethyl 2-amino-1-(4-bromophenyl)-1H-pyrrolo[2,3-b]quinoxaline-3-carboxylate is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 83.03 Ų falls within the moderate polarity range, balancing permeability and solubility for ethyl 2-amino-1-(4-bromophenyl)-1H-pyrrolo[2,3-b]quinoxaline-3-carboxylate. Following Lipinski's Rule of Five, ethyl 2-amino-1-(4-bromophenyl)-1H-pyrrolo[2,3-b]quinoxaline-3-carboxylate has 1 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
